Innovation in materials and manufacturing processes is the cornerstone for shaping the future of pipe fitting standards. Advanced materials such as high-performance polymers and corrosion-resistant alloys are changing the landscape. These materials not only enhance the longevity of pipes and fittings but also reduce the environmental footprint associated with mining and processing traditional materials. Pipe fitting manufacturers are set to leverage these innovations, leading to more durable and sustainable products that meet or exceed regulatory standards.
Moreover, the advent of smart technologies is revolutionizing how piping systems are monitored and managed. Internet of Things (IoT) devices, for instance, allow for real-time monitoring of pipe integrity, fluid flow, and pressure levels. This data-driven approach enables pipe fitting manufacturers to develop standards that emphasize predictive maintenance rather than reactive repairs. Consequently, industries can experience minimized downtime and enhanced operational efficiency. Future standards will likely incorporate guidelines that incentivize the adoption of such technologies, ensuring the pipes of tomorrow are not only stronger but smarter.
In addition to material advancements and smart technologies, the digital transformation of manufacturing processes is reshaping the landscape for pipe fitting standards. Techniques such as 3D printing and computer-aided design (CAD) are enabling manufacturers to create custom fittings with unprecedented precision and speed. This level of customization was previously unheard of in the industry and is proving essential as various sectors demand specific solutions to complex challenges. Future standards will evolve to accommodate new manufacturing methods, pushing the envelope on what is possible in pipe fitting design and functionality.

Quality control will take on new dimensions in light of these innovations. Advanced testing methods, including non-destructive testing (NDT) and machine learning algorithms for defect detection, are garnering attention. These improvements will drive the development of enhanced standards to ensure that every piece of equipment meets the highest criteria before it reaches the marketplace. By adopting rigorous quality measures, pipe fitting manufacturers can instill greater consumer confidence in their products while also safeguarding public safety.
